Natasha Barnard

Natasha Barnard

Natasha Barnard's Rating: 9.04/10info

Based on 52 votes from Hotness Rater voters

Won Against

  • Nadja Purtschert
    8.54/10
    Cora Emmanuel
    8.48/10
    Manushi Chhillar
    8.30/10
  • Serena Marija
    7.81/10
    Nikki Sims
    Unrated
    Jojo Babie - ass
    Unrated

Lost Against

  • Nereyda Bird
    7.43/10
    Alyssa Miller in body paint
    Unrated
    Frida Gustavsson
    Unrated
  • Tawna Eubanks McCoy
    Unrated